概括
无花果植物光皮炎会引起疼痛的晒伤类皮肤反应. 在温暖的气候下接触常见无花果树 (Ficus carica) 可以引发这种情况,需要适当的诊断和治疗.

背景情况:
- 植物光皮炎是一种由植物汁液和阳光照射引起的皮肤反应.
- 常见的无花果树 (Ficus carica) 是一种潜在的,但经常被忽视的植物光皮炎的原因.

主要成果:
- 患者会出现突然的,痛苦的,类似晒伤的喷发.
- 症状随着时间的推移而恶化,呈现为线性,红血性,水泡状的皮疹.
结论:
- 无花果植物光皮炎是一种独特的临床实体,皮肤科医生应该考虑.
- 迅速识别Ficus carica作为诱发剂对于有效的患者管理和治疗至关重要.
